"The Big Bang Theory", Lucasfilm Team for "Star Wars Day" Episode (Exclusive)
4/2/14
by Lesley Goldberg
These may be the Jedi you are looking for.
CBS' "The Big Bang Theory" is teaming with Lucasfilm for an epic Star Wars episode timed to "Star Wars Day", The Hollywood Reporter has learned.
In 'The Proton Transmogrification' -- the episode set to air May 1 and timed to the annual May 4 "Star Wars Day" -- the gang gets together to celebrate the annual geek holiday, while Sheldon (Jim Parsons) is guided by visions of his childhood idol and mentor, Professor Proton (Emmy winner Bob Newhart), who appears to the socially challenged genius as his own Jedi master.
For those not in the know, "Star Wars Day" is recognized every year on May 4, with the traditional celebratory greeting being "May the fourth be with you" -- a play on Star Wars' famed "May the Force be with you" line.
Fans across the globe celebrate the film franchise with screenings and special events.
For the episode, the CBS comedy teamed with a group of special effects technicians from Lucasfilm's Industrial Light & Magic to re-create Dagobah -- the remote world of swamps and forest that served as a refuge for Yoda during his exile -- and provide props for the episode, including a light saber.
Lucasfilm experts consulted on the episode and visited "The Big Bang Theory" set to oversee the production, with the final touches completed at its San Francisco headquarters.
"We were approached by the Lucasfilm people to do something to celebrate Star Wars Day, which was nice," co-creator Chuck Lorre tells THR.
Added showrunner Steve Molaro: "We knew that Bob was coming back and Lucasfilm called us, and we realized that that this might be an opportunity to mix both stories and come up with something special."
